  • Investment Income Includes INTEREST, DIVIDENDS, CAPITAL GAINS and other types of DISTRIBUTIONS. See IRS Publication 550, Investment Income and Expenses (Including Capital Gains and Losses). Nonrefundable Credit A credit which CANNOT EXCEED the taxpayer's tax liability. Refundable Credit A credit for which the IRS will send the taxpayer a REFUND for any amount in EXCESS of the taxpayer's tax liability.
